What’s All the Fuss with LTE-U? Just Follow the Money
The LTE-U / LAA debate heats up and raises the Noise Floor, reducing the Signal-to-Noise ratio and leading to diminished signal quality. Many of the arguments pro and con wash over critical issues that come to light when one follows the Hollywood dictum, “Follow the Money.” FRND IPR royalties aside, the concentration of IPR and the impact to infrastructure sunk CapEx make LTE in unlicensed spectrum at best an odious proposition for many in the ecosystem.
